Transaction 6661c41bc0452cf1c8a3521056fd59058db8b949eb67943e612d69d0f8fa2a63
1 Input
1 Output
-
6661c41bc0452cf1c8a3521056fd59058db8b949eb67943e612d69d0f8fa2a63:0
- value
- 545169
- script pubkey
- OP_0 OP_PUSHBYTES_20 83405d50e71a222ddd155936ab42d97e45281498
- address
- bc1qsdq96588rg3zmhg4tym2kske0ezjs9yct8zfct